Kingsland is the jewel of Camden County and promotes a number of events each year for Kingsland and neighboring St. Mary’s and Woodbine. These festivals and celebrations are a perfect opportunity to get outdoors and explore all of Mother Nature’s offerings while enjoying live music, good food, and merriment with friends. Annual Celebrations
Mardi Gras Festival -
Friday & Saturday in February
Kingsland Spring Carnival
Spring
Crawfish Festival - Last Friday & Saturday in April
Independence Day Festival -
July 4th
Seafood Festival - 1st Saturday in October
Kingsland Fall Carnival
Mid-Fall
Catfish Festival - Saturday before Thanksgiving
A Snowy Kingsland Christmas - 1st Thursday in December
